Gay Rights Group Denounces McCain; Endorses Obama
By On Top Magazine Staff
Published: June 10, 2008

http://www.ontopmag.com/article.aspx?id=1798&MediaType=1&Category=25

Senator John McCain wants gays and lesbians to think of him as being gay-friendly, or, at least, gay-comfortable. For instance, he has kept mum on gay nuptials in California set to begin next week. And a recent appearance on Ellen DeGeneres' daytime talk show where he gently spars with the openly-out DeGeneres on marriage was suppose to appear respectful of gays.

For gay rights group Human Rights Campaign (HRC) that was not enough. In a new video and campaign, posted at its hrc.org website, the nation's largest gay rights group argues that McCain is no friend of GLBT people.
